It must be a 'The Master' kind of day. First the movie poster was released and now we have a full on theatrical trailer, and if you liked the teasers, this makes the movie look even more incredible.
There is still not too much of the story revealed, but I feel like the center of the film is going to be the relationship between Philip Seymour Hoffman and Joaquin Phoenix (with a dash of Amy Adams added in). Visually it looks pretty spectacular. It seems to be going more along the lines of P.T. Anderson's There Will Be Blood than Magnolia.
